Posted by TN on 08/07/2009
If you love eating out, you'll hate this place.
You've seen the situation on TV before - a guy goes into a fancy restaurant, orders an entree and is shocked to see a plate containing only two slices of beef. This is that place, minus all aspects of fanciness. First off, this place is SMALL, even by NYC standards. There were only about 7 people in the place and it was cramped. I was literally sitting 6 inches from the exit door. Second, we ordered miso soup and kenchin jiru. This miso soup is no better than the ones you get for free with your meal at many other Japanese restaurants, except it'll costs you $4 here. The kenchin jiru is mixed veggies with water and soy sauce. Very bland. I got the Tofu Steak. I love real steak. Give me a 10oz medium-rare ribeye and I'm a happy man. Give me two slices of tofu that's smaller than a slice of my morning toast and I'm not a happy man. My girlfriend got the Spicy Tuna bowl. This was ok. My girlfriend is a very light eater, loves sushi and loves avocado. She wasn't a huge fan of this. I agree that the dishes are not very expensive, but that's because you hardly get any food from it. I have nothing against tofu or soy. I eat plenty of tofu and soy products. Lots of places prepare soy-based foods very well. This is not one of them.
